Citations
3 citations on file for this inspection.
1926.416 A01
- Issued
- Jul 10, 2017
- Penalty
- Initial $1,385 · Current $900 Reduced
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.416(a)(1): No employer shall permit an employee to work in such proximity to any part of an electric power circuit that the employee could contact the electric power circuit in the course of work, unless the employee is protected against electric shock by deenergizing the circuit and grounding it or by guarding it effectively by insulation or other means. a. On or about March 23, 2017 - at the above addressed jobsite, employees were required to access / egress a roof top in close proximity to a residential electrical utility Service lateral / Service Drop. Employees were thereby exposed to electrical burns / shock. b. Employees were observed working above or around a residential electrical utility Service lateral / Service Drop at the time of inspection. Employees were thereby exposed to electrical burns / shock. c. At the time of inspection, there existed a "toe board" affixed to the roof directly behind the residential electrical utility Service lateral / Service Drop, showing previous exposure to the installing employee. There is no abatement certification or documentation required for this item.

1926.501 B13
- Issued
- Jul 10, 2017
- Penalty
- Initial $1,630 · Current $900 Reduced
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.501(b)(13): "Residential construction." Each employee engaged in residential construction activities 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above lower levels shall be protected by guardrail systems, safety net system, or personal fall arrest system unless another provision in paragraph (b) of this section provides for an alternative fall protection measure. On or about March 23, 2017, employees performing residential roofing installation operations at a residential property were exposed to a 8' foot fall hazard when the employer failed to ensure fall protection was utilized. No abatement certification or documentation is required for this item.

1926.20 B02
- Issued
- Jul 10, 2017
- Penalty
- Initial $0 · Current $0
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.20(b)(2): The employer did not initiate and maintain programs which provided for frequent and regular inspections of the job site, materials and equipment to be made by a competent person(s): a. On or about October 31, 2016, at the above addressed jobsite, safety inspections were not made by competent persons capable of identifying and correcting those hazards which could result in employee injuries. Employees were thereby exposed to falls and electrical hazards at this jobsite. Abatement documentation is required for this item in accordance with 29 CFR 1903.19(c).
